Transaction 38eac12c52b8cfa10491949be1efcd61c7a356d03418e162d24db51ddffc1e9a

1 Input
2 Outputs
  • 38eac12c52b8cfa10491949be1efcd61c7a356d03418e162d24db51ddffc1e9a:0
  • value  17076930000
    address  1ANjD4VCT5692Lks5DDamcafijE5d6jMeX
  • 38eac12c52b8cfa10491949be1efcd61c7a356d03418e162d24db51ddffc1e9a:1
  • value  7880000
    address  1BtS7BB6Lx1V6P4pGnbnpdX3qjwSdqEkLn